I can't let this thread die this easily. Am I going insane or is the Thermalright HR-03 PLUS the
ONLY GeForce 8800GTX third party cooler on the market. There has got to be a better solution that the monstrosity that is the HR-03 PLUS. It's huge and with it's alternative configuration it's ok with one card but not SLI since the second card could not be fit in that alternative configuration including the 92mm fan to cool it. If you put it in normal configuration on the bottom SLI VGA Card then you take up 4 slots which might include precious PCI slots of things like Sound Cards or Wireless PCI or other things. Plus in alternate configuration the top SLI card may have issues with sharing space on some Large CPU coolers. So obviously someone needs to come up with an alternate design that is better than stock coolers and is more friendly towards SLI configurations.
